Stability

With four wheels and a centre of gravity that's balanced by the weight of your child in the seat, 4-wheel buggies are generally considered to be more stable than three-wheelers. But that doesn't mean an older model with three wheels isn't worth a look, since many of these models are designed to handle anything from rough terrain to bustling high streets.

Look for a buggy with large rear wheels, and one that locks on the front. This will make it easier to drive and less likely to snap apart on rough roads. These all-terrain buggies also come with pneumatic tires, which are ideal for handling non-paved surfaces. They can be used on sandy beaches or tracks in woodlands.

These are also the best buggies for running around in, as they provide great stability on rough terrain and can help you keep pace with your running partner. They can also be used to go up and down steep kerbs, and many come with a spring suspension that is built-in, so your baby can enjoy a smooth ride.

One factor that makes a pushchair with three wheels difficult to maneuver is the broad frame, which makes it difficult to squeeze through tight spaces and narrow doors than a four-wheeler. However, some manufacturers have tackled this issue with a clever design that makes the wheels flip upwards when not in use, which decreases their overall size and allows you get through doors easily.

Manoeuvrability

Three-wheeled buggies are more movable than four-wheeled strollers. They typically come with a swivelling front wheel that lets you change direction quickly and steer using just one hand. Some also come with a lockable front wheel which gives you stability on rougher terrain. Some models can even be used with a second seat or buggy board if you're looking to increase the size of your family.

If you intend to remove your three-wheeled buggies from the roads that are paved, you should choose a model that has pneumatic tyres. They can handle even the most difficult terrain. They may have to be filled from time to intervals, but they'll be more durable and puncture-proof compared to solid tyres. Find a model with a the ability to lock the swivelling wheel on the front to help you negotiate tricky surfaces.

When folded, three-wheelers can be heavier than buggies with four wheels due to the single wheel in front. Be sure that the model you pick fits inside your car's boot and can be placed upright if needed. Certain models can be folded by one hand, and they stand up when collapsed. This will save space in the boot of your car.

Fabric Sling Seat

The primary distinction between a fabric and a modular one is the fabric sling. It sits inside the buggy frame, rather than being positioned on top like an adjustable chair. This allows for a more ergonomically correct position for babies that instantly gives a lower centre of gravity and a more appropriate height. This results in an easier push, a less hefty curb pop (you don't require as much weight and effort to push the buggy over the curb's edge) and a better balance and stability.

These buggy seats also feature Sling fabrics that are simple to clean and durable. These fabrics were developed specifically for Sling chairs and are highly durable and breathable. They also have a great anti-aging capability and are easy to clean with mild soap and water.

3-wheel buggies are particularly good for off-road or all terrain adventures as they have more stability than strollers with four wheels. The large front wheel that is extremely maneuverable allows for smooth and agile movement. The tyres, which are typically air-filled and come with suspension, offer a comfortable ride on even the most rough trails and roads. The wheels are not as close to the ground on these pushchairs as they are with 4 wheeled pushchairs. This makes them ideal for walking uphill.

Parents who like to run and jog with their children usually opt for strollers with three wheels because they're more agile and sleeker than their 4-wheel counterparts.
